Punitive Damages in South Carolina DUI Cases
Unlike ordinary negligence cases, DUI accident claims often qualify for punitive damages — compensation designed to punish the drunk driver and deter future reckless behavior. In South Carolina, courts recognize that choosing to drive drunk is willful and reckless misconduct.
Punitive damages can significantly increase your total recovery beyond med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ering. An experienced DUI accident attorney knows how to document and present your claim to maximize these damages.
The criminal DUI case and your civil injury claim are separate. You can pursue full compensation even if the driver is acquitted or pleads to a lesser charge.
